Specifications

  • Ingredients: Rabbit, rabbit liver, rabbit heart, rabbit kidney, rabbit lung, herring oil, mixed tocopherols (preservative), vitamin E supplement, zinc amino acid complex, iron amino acid complex, copper amino acid complex, manganese amino acid complex.
  • Guaranteed Analysis: Crude Fiber, max: 5% | Crude Fat, min: 15% | Crude Protein, min: 55% | Moisture, max: 8%
  • Metabolizable Energy: ME = 4102 kcal/kg | ME = 244 kcal/cup
